Top Materials for Building a Stone Fireplace in Owings Mills, MD
When building a stone fireplace in Owings Mills, MD, it’s essential to choose materials that offer both durability and aesthetic appeal.
Natural stone options like granite, limestone, and slate provide long-lasting beauty and heat resistance.
Additionally, consider using locally sourced stone to blend with the area’s architectural style and ensure a seamless integration with your home’s design.
Each material has its unique texture and colour, allowing for a customized look to match your personal style.
When selecting materials for your stone fireplace in Owings Mills, MD, consider the following factors:
- Durability: Choose a stone that can withstand high temperatures and regular use without cracking or deteriorating
- Aesthetics: Opt for a stone color and texture that complements your great room’s design scheme
- Maintenance: Consider the level of upkeep required for different stone types, such as regular sealing or cleaning
Some popular stone options for Owings Mills, MD fireplaces include:
Stone Type | Pros | Cons |
---|---|---|
Natural Fieldstone | Rustic charm, unique texture, locally sourced | Irregular shapes can be challenging to install |
Manufactured Stone Veneer | Consistent sizing, wide color range, easy installation | May lack the authenticity of natural stone |
Eco-Friendly Recycled Stone | Sustainable, distinctive appearance, durable | Limited color and texture options compared to new stone |
Ultimately, the best material for your stone fireplace will depend on your personal preferences, budget, and the overall style of your Owings Mills, MD home.
Ensuring Proper Scale and Proportion for Your Stone Fireplace in Owings Mills, MD
Ensuring proper scale and proportion for your stone fireplace in Owings Mills, MD, is essential for creating a balanced and visually appealing design.
The size of the fireplace should complement the room’s dimensions, with the stone material chosen to enhance the overall aesthetic.
Properly scaled proportions prevent the fireplace from overwhelming the space or appearing too small.
A well-designed fireplace can become a focal point that harmonizes with other architectural elements in your home.
To ensure your stone fireplace is well-proportioned and suitable for your great room, follow these guidelines:
- 1. Fireplace Width: The fireplace width should be approximately 2/3 to 3/4 the width of the room
- 2. Mantel Height: Position the mantel 4 to 5 feet above the hearth, or about 12 inches above the fireplace opening
- 3. Hearth Depth: Ensure the hearth extends at least 16 inches from the fireplace and is at least 2 inches thick
When in doubt, consult with a local designer or contractor who can assess your space and provide personalized recommendations for your stone fireplace dimensions.
Incorporating Comfortable Seating Around Your Stone Fireplace in Owings Mills, MD
To create an inviting gathering spot around your stone fireplace, consider the following seating arrangements:
Arrangement | Pros | Cons |
---|---|---|
Symmetrical | Creates a balanced, formal look | Can feel rigid or uninviting |
Asymmetrical | Offers a more relaxed, casual vibe | May lack visual harmony if not carefully planned |
Built-in Seating | Maximizes space and integrates with the fireplace design | Less flexibility for rearranging furniture |
When selecting furniture, prioritize comfort and choose pieces that complement your stone fireplace’s style and color palette.
Consider incorporating a mix of seating options, such as a cozy loveseat, armchairs, and floor cushions, to accommodate various needs and preferences.
Common Design Mistakes to Avoid When Planning a Stone Fireplace in Owings Mills, MD
When planning a stone fireplace in Owings Mills, MD, it’s crucial to avoid several common design mistakes.
One is choosing the wrong stone material that doesn’t complement the room’s style or climate.
Another mistake is not considering the fireplace’s size in relation to the room, leading to either an overpowering or underwhelming focal point.
Additionally, neglecting proper ventilation can result in safety issues and inefficiency.
Lastly, failing to plan for the necessary clearances around the fireplace can lead to costly code violations and fire hazards.
To ensure a successful stone fireplace design, avoid these common mistakes:
- Choosing a stone that clashes with your home’s overall style or color scheme
- Selecting a fireplace size that overwhelms or underwhelms the room
- Neglecting proper ventilation and heat distribution, leading to potential safety hazards
- Failing to consult with local professionals who understand Owings Mills, MD’s building codes and regulations
By working with experienced designers and contractors, you can sidestep these pitfalls and create a stone fireplace that is both beautiful and functional.
